Presentation script for the 1969 film, copy belonging to producer Harry Mandell, with his name in gilt on the front board. A woman breaks off her engagement with her fiance when he becomes violent after she has an abortion, only to be stalked by him when she later has a child with her new husband. An early, grim New Hollywood entry, directed by Val Lewton veteran Mark Robson, and one of the first screenwriting efforts by Larry Cohen. . Shot on location in San Francisco. Green calf leather boards with gilt titles and rule, and with producer Harry Mandell's name in gilt at the bottom right corner of the front board. Title page present, dated August 7, 1968, with credits for screenwriters Lorenzo Semple Jr. and Larry Cohen. 119 leaves, with last page of text numbered 133. Title page in blue typescript, remainder of script mimegoraph, rectos only. Pages and boards Fine.
